Chelsy Leavis from AliceMare
Chelsy is a plot-important character in the 2016 pixel horror game, Alicemare, created by Miwashiba.
She is the game’s iteration of Little Red Riding Hood, and the second one of the children taken in by Teacher that Allen, the player character, goes to visit over the course of the story.
Chelsy has a very muted toned palette, with her hair and eyes both being a light brown color, and the rest of her outfits in soft reds and whites. She wears her hair low in two small pigtails, tied with red beaded hairties, and her outfit is a long sleeved bell skirted red dress with a poofy white petticoat giving it shape, with a small white apron over top, a matching white-lace trimmed red caplet with a hood that’s usually worn down, white socks, and lace up black boots with brown soles.
Raimu (Rhyme) Bito from The World Ends With You
Rhyme (voiced in Japanese by Hitomi Nabatame [TWEWY]/Ayana Taketatsu [anime/KH/NEO] and in English by Kate Higgins [TWEWY]/Ashley Rose [TWEWY/KH/NEO]/Dani Chambers [anime]) is one of the main characters in The World Ends With You (game/anime).
She is the younger sister of Beat, and while not technically one of the partner characters for the Reaper’s Game, she is very important to Beat’s story and how he got there in the first place.
Rhyme has chin length light blonde hair that she wears a loose dark grey beanie over, with a black and white skull pin matching her brother’s beanie, and blue eyes. She wears a creamsicle colored long sleeved shirt with a dark grey heart stylized skull and crossbones across the entire front, and a pair of short white overalls worn with the top half flopped over. Her shoes are yellow and black, similar in style to Sora’s from Kingdom Hearts, and she wears a bell on a necklace cord.
Joshua Kiryu from The World Ends With You
Joshua (voiced in Japanese by Ryōhei Kimura, and in English by Aaron Spann [games]/Clifford Chapin [anime] is one of the main characters and also one of Neku’s biggest problems in the anime/game series The World Ends With You.
He is the second person that Neku partners with while in the Reaper’s Game, and can be rather insufferable to most of the people around him, though he gets along relatively well with Mr. Hanekoma.
Joshua has near shoulder length wavy ash blonde hair, and grey violet eyes. His usual outfit is a greyish purple collared button down short-sleeved shirt with white cuffs, that he wears untucked, and a pair of wide ankle grey pants. It’s finished off with white lace up shoes with dark grey soles.
Unknown from Mystic Messenger
In Mystic Messenger, Unknown (real name Saeran Choi) is the twin brother of 707 and an acolyte of the cult Mint Eye. In terms of appearance, he has mint color eyes, and vermillion-colored hair with frosted pink highlights. He wears a black leather jacket that he tends to let hang off his right shoulder.
Yoosung Kim from Mystic Messenger
Yoosung Kim is a character in the otome game Mystic Messenger. Yoosung doesn’t spend as much time studying for his college courses as he should because he plays the addictive computer game LOLOL. Yoosung has dyed blonde hair that he pins back on one side with two hairpins. Yoosung’s everyday outfit includes brown pants and shoes, a shirt with green, blue, and tan stripes, and a blue overshirt which he wears unbuttoned. He accessorizes with several pins including a red star and yellow smiley face.

Gray from Brawl Stars
In Brawl Stars, Gray is a monochromatic mythic brawler. He’s a mischievous mime, whose attacks rely on a fake finger gun and dropping grand pianos on enemies’ heads. His Super, Dimension Doors, opens a portal that allows him to teleport across the map — quite handy for making a prison escape.
